1-2: historical introduction and overview of the course. Voltaire reported the chinese custom of taking dried powders of smallpox crusts, preventing the contraction of the disease later in life. Circassians practiced a form of vaccination; gave their children smallpox in their infant years to protect their life and beauty: first reports of prophylactic immunization immunization that can prevent an infectious disease. Killed organisms are unlikely to deplete the vital foodstuff. Roux and yersin showed that a bacterium free filtrate of the diptheria bacillus contains exotoxin and if given to an animal, could cause its death. Immune serum serum obtained from an immune animal. Administration to normal unimmunized animals conferred resistance: passive immunization the attainment of protection by an unimmunized individual upon the transfer or either serum or cells from an immune individual. Demonstrates that there are protective molecules in immune serum: antibodies protective molecules in immune serum, antigens molecules/substances to which antibodies specifically bind.
